To check the exact number of points supported by your device, try this There's a small zone in between buttons to assist with pushing 2 at once and will be configurable in a future update. This may sound a bit counterintuitive, but increasing the button spacing makes this zone larger so it's actually easier to push multiple buttons in the case where your thumb is over both (the OS should interpolate the location to the middle and have a better chance of hitting the in-between bounding box).
